Description

Road construction engineering isolating device
Technical field
The utility model relates to road construction engineering device technique fields, more particularly to road construction engineering isolating device.
Background technique
Need to use blocking apparatus in the construction process to prevent vehicle from travelling to construction area, existing method is to apply Work edges of regions is arranged roadblock according to a fixed spacing and passes through placing pedestrian or vehicle driving.
But existing barrier structures are simple, have a single function, and when placing, spacing is excessive, does not have buffer action, especially It is that cannot prevent pedestrian from passing through, spacing is too small, results in waste of resources, it is therefore desirable to it is a kind of both to have kept more distantly located, The device of comprehensive isolation construction area and pedestrian or vehicle can be played again, and rationally utilizes resource, avoid wasting.
It is combined in the prior art and with stock or plate structure come interception car and pedestrian, due to being needed on road The region shape constructed is indefinite, and the shape that rod-like structure or plate structure can not preferably be bonded construction area is set It sets.
Utility model content
For above situation, for the defect for overcoming the prior art, the utility model provides road construction engineering isolation dress It sets, solves the problem of existing blocking apparatus structure is simple, has a single function, and rod-like structure angle is fixed, and inconvenience is adjusted.
Its technical solution is road construction engineering isolating device, including column ontology, and the column ontology is a plurality of branch The triangular pyramid that strut collectively forms is fixedly connected by welding between each support rod, setting in the column ontology There is a telescopic device for interception, the telescopic device includes the length-adjustable flexible railing with contractile function and for stretching The packaging container with cavity that contracting railing is fixed and installed, the flexible railing are made of stainless steel telescopic rod, described flexible Railing is rotatablely connected by ball link and packaging container, and the flexible railing is fixed on packaging container to be made with shrinking connecting-rod cooperation In cavity, each side of column ontology is provided with the channel passed through for flexible railing, each channel and telescopic device Positioned at same level height, movement forms different angles to adjacent flexible railing in the channel, according to the shape in road construction region Shape is defined, and the channel is the rectangle ring that both ends are provided with connecting rod, and each described connecting rod one end is fixed with channel side The support rod of welding, the connecting rod other end and composition column ontology is fixedly welded, and channel is fixed on column sheet by connecting rod On each side of body.
Further, graduation mark is provided on the channel, the graduation mark is used for flexible convenient for users to accurately holding The move angle of railing.
Further, each channel lower position is provided with warning panel, and each warning panel is in isosceles trapezoid, each described Warning panel both ends are provided with buckle, and each buckle makes made of plastic and solid with warning back by way of gluing Fixed connection, each buckle is arced tube structure, and elastic deformation occurs by plastic buckle and column ontology is fastened or dismantled, Each warning back that is buckled in is obliquely installed, and the one side that the support rod of the buckle and composition column ontology fits is arranged There is a rubber pad, the rubber pad one side and buckle gluing, another side are provided with for anti-skidding slanted bar lines, in the warning panel It is arranged fluted, the warning panel is provided with cover board made of transparent plastic towards user's on one side, the cover board and warning Being formed between plate groove can be used for placing the interlayer with mark property cardboard, and the side edge thereof is provided with gasket and passes through Gasket and groove clamping, any corner of cover board be provided with can by the invagination slot that cover board is plucked out out of groove, it is described in Sunken slot is recessed inwardly by side edge thereof to be formed.
Further, single stretch balustrade length extend to the limit still can not by road construction region and non-construction area every In the case where opening, then multiple column ontologies is needed to cooperate, the flexible railing concaves far from one end end face of packaging container It falls into and forms groove body, the magnetic patch for different flexible Baluster end flexible connections is provided in the groove body, each magnetic patch is embedding Enter and be fixedly connected by way of gluing in groove body with groove body surface, each magnetic patch surface is held with flexible Baluster end plane It is flat.
Further, the vias inner walls surface is provided with invagination slot, is provided with columned rolling item in the invagination slot, Each rolling item is arranged successively and is laterally arranged, and each rolling end is located in invagination slot, each rolling eminence channel table Sliding friction is changed into rolling friction under the action of each rolling item, subtracted by face 1mm-3mm, the movement in channel of flexible railing The abrasion of flexible railing less.
Further, column ontology bottom surface is provided with bottom plate, each support rod of the bottom plate and column ontology bottom surface It is fixedly welded, the installation position that can steadily place telescopic device is provided in the column ontology, the installation position is greater than for area The plate structure of storage box bottom surface is fixedly connected between the installation position and bottom plate by support rod, described support rod one end with Bottom plate is fixedly welded, and the support rod other end is fixedly welded with installation position, and it is intrinsic that the telescopic device is placed on column On installation position.
Further, loop bar is provided on the bottom plate, the loop bar is fixedly connected by welding with bottom plate, institute The multiple annular sleeve blocks for being arranged on loop bar and being used cooperatively with loop bar are stated, the loop bar is cylindrical rod, and each set block uses density Biggish such as iron block, lead metal material are poured, and each set block size is consistent, and weight is consistent, column ontology itself Limited mass, and flexible railing extends outwardly will lead to gravity center instability, encounters strong wind weather and is easy to topple over, by solid with bottom plate Housing sleeve block can reinforce the stability of column ontology on fixed loop bar.
The utility model has the technical effect that, is cooperated by multiple column ontologies, according to the case where construction area pairs The length of flexible railing is adjusted, isolation construction area and non-construction area, while playing a warning role to pedestrian, vehicle, Content is replaceable in warning panel, can be applied to a variety of construction sites, and column ontology stability is strong, is not easy to topple over, arrangement mode letter It is single, and can be adjusted in time according to construction speed, rationally utilize space resources.
